QCOM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2014 in Review

1,567 of the 3,463 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Qualcomm (QCOM) for Q1 2014, worth a combined $106B — up 6.4% from $99.2B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 101 funds opened new QCOM positions and 74 closed out — a net gain of 27 holders — while 690 added to existing stakes and 625 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Vanguard Group, adding an estimated $1.01B. The largest seller was T. Rowe Price Associates, cutting an estimated $972M.
